logo

Output 592a3c315014a604b726e1aa7ed0455bca2a12c1cb0d6400a512a90dae15dbae:2

value
34977639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c7135d18ed8849f15c512350f8ca2331cb0992 OP_EQUAL
address
358mQfCSVq4M5ef8hdcod8MZRKTwwEkxU6
transaction
592a3c315014a604b726e1aa7ed0455bca2a12c1cb0d6400a512a90dae15dbae